    John and the Zealots fought in the civil war with these two factions until he was finally captured by Titus during the Siege of Jerusalem. He was sentenced to life imprisonment, taken to Rome and paraded through the streets in chains. Legacy. He was the subject of the Italian drama Giovanni di Giscala (1754) by Alfonso Varano.

    Zealot (Lady Zannah) is a comic book superhero who has appeared in books published by Wildstorm Productions and DC Comics. Created by artist Jim Lee and writer Brandon Choi , she first appeared in WildC.A.T.s #1 (August 1992), as a member of that titular superhero team, during the period when Wildstorm and its properties were owned by Jim Lee.

    Sicarii ( Daggermen) was a Jewish terrorist group active in Israel [1] [2] that took responsibility for a series of terrorist attacks between 1989 and 1990 on Palestinians and Jewish political and media figures considered sympathetic to the plight of Palestinians. Jacob Lumbrozo (born in Lisbon in an unknown year – died between September 24, 1665 and May 31, 1666), also known as John Lumbroso, was a Portuguese -born physician, farmer, and trader resident in the British colony of Maryland in the middle of the 17th century.
